Embracing the Beauty of Hanfu:A Journey for Plus-Size Middle School Students

In the vibrant world of Chinese traditional culture, Hanfu has gained immense popularity. This beautiful attire, with its intricate designs and rich history, is worn proudly by people across the globe. However, for plus-Size middle school students, finding suitable Hanfu that accentuates their beauty might be a challenge. This article explores the experience of wearing Hanfu for overweight young students, highlighting the importance of self-expression and confidence.

For many middle school students, the onset of puberty brings about physical changes that can often leave them feeling self-conscious and uncomfortable. For those who are considered plus-size, finding clothing that fits both their personality and school regulations can be a daunting task. The beauty of Hanfu lies in its adaptability and ability to cater to different body types. However, the perception of wearing traditional attire for overweight individuals is often limited, leading many to miss out on the joy of embracing their cultural heritage.

Firstly, it's crucial to understand that Hanfu is not just about the clothing but also about the spirit of self-expression and confidence. It's about embracing your body and wearing it proudly, regardless of size. Plus-size middle school students should be encouraged to explore their options in Hanfu, understanding that there's a style that suits them best. They can find a variety of Hanfu designs that cater to their body type, from loose-fitting tops to comfortable pants.

Moreover, wearing Hanfu offers an opportunity for plus-size students to connect with their cultural roots. As they explore different styles and designs, they can learn about the rich history and culture associated with Hanfu. This connection can help them appreciate their identity and feel more confident about their appearance.
